National Museum Bloemfontein
Kicking off our Bloemfontein adventure, the National Museum Bloemfontein is the perfect starting point to immerse yourself in the rich tapestry of local history and culture. Nestled in the heart of the city at 36 Aliwal Street, this museum offers a captivating exploration of natural history, cultural artifacts, and an array of fascinating exhibits. With an hour to wander through its halls, you'll find yourself transported through time, gaining a deeper understanding of the region's heritage and the stories that shaped it.
Attraction Info
- 36 Aliwal St, Bloemfontein Central, Bloemfontein, 9301, South Africa
- Suggested tour duration: 1-3 hour
- Open on Mon-Fri,8:00am-5:00pm;Open on Sat,10:00am-3:00pm

Hertzog Square
Next on our itinerary, just a stone's throw from the National Museum, Hertzog Square offers a serene escape amidst the bustling cityscape. Located at 8 President Brand Street, this square is a hub of civic pride and a testament to Bloemfontein's historical significance. Spend an hour here basking in the ambiance of this public space, where art installations, memorials, and manicured gardens provide a picturesque backdrop for a leisurely stroll or a moment of reflection.
Attraction Info
- 8 President Brand St, Bloemfontein Central, Bloemfontein, 9301, South Africa
- Suggested tour duration: 1-2 hour
Oliewenhuis Art Museum
Concluding our day with artistic inspiration, the Oliewenhuis Art Museum, situated at 16 Harry Smith Street, is a sanctuary for art enthusiasts. With two hours to revel in its exhibitions, this art museum, housed in a former state residence, showcases a stunning collection of South African art. From contemporary pieces to historical works, the museum's diverse array of art is thoughtfully curated to engage and inspire visitors, making it an essential finale to our Bloemfontein cultural journey.
Attraction Info
- 16 Harry Smith St, Dan Pienaar, Bloemfontein, 9301, South Africa
- Suggested tour duration: 2-3 hour
- Open on Mon-Fri,8:00am-5:00pm;Open on Sat-Sun,9:00am-4:00pm
